Damaged tile replacement services involve removing and replacing broken, cracked, or otherwise compromised tiles to restore the appearance and functionality of tiled surfaces. This process typically includes carefully removing the damaged tiles without harming surrounding materials, preparing the underlying surface, and installing new tiles that match the existing design. Skilled service providers ensure that the replacement tiles are properly aligned and sealed, helping to maintain the integrity of the surface and prevent further issues such as water infiltration or structural damage.
This service addresses common problems such as cracked or chipped tiles, loose tiles, and tiles that have become discolored or stained over time. Damaged tiles can compromise the safety of a space by creating uneven surfaces or sharp edges, and they can also lead to water damage if cracks allow moisture to seep beneath the surface. Replacing damaged tiles helps prevent further deterioration, preserves the aesthetic appeal of the property, and can improve the overall durability of tiled areas.

Material Costs - Replacing damaged tiles typically involves material costs ranging from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the tile type. For example, ceramic tiles may cost around $4 per square foot, while natural stone tiles can be $8 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for damaged tile replacement generally fall between $45 and $75 per hour. The total cost depends on the extent of damage and the complexity of removing and installing new tiles.
Additional Supplies - Additional costs for supplies such as grout, adhesive, and underlayment can add $50 to $150 to the overall project. These costs vary based on the size of the area and the materials chosen.
Project Scope - Small repairs, like replacing a few tiles, may cost between $150 and $300. Larger areas requiring extensive removal and replacement can range from $500 to over $1,500, depending on the size and tile type.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
